NSYNC’s JC Chasez and Lance Bass have revealed how the band isn’t ruling out a potential tour or new album, following their reunion at this year’s MTV VMAs. In the meantime, Justin Timberlake is reportedly set to hit the road for his own solo tour across North America in 2024.
